/** * Tests for audit-logger PII masking parity [DC-110]: * - audit-logger.js (the StateManager write path) must mask emails with * the SAME canonical primitives as the unified logger (DC-095): * resource strings (URL paths like /invites//accept) and deep * details objects (req.body.email, DC-048 userEmail attribution). * - Masking happens at the single write-point log(), so middleware AND * direct route calls are both covered. * - Middleware's sensitive-key '***' redaction (password/token/…) * survives — masking runs on the already-sanitized object. * - The caller's `details` object is never mutated (maskEmails clones). * * Hermetic: AUDIT_LOG_FILE and SECURITY_EVENT_LOG_FILE are pointed at a * tmp dir BEFORE the require — both modules resolve paths at load time. * * Read discipline: StateManager writes via fs.writeFile (truncate-then- * write, NOT atomic) and middleware fires log() unawaited, so a fixed * sleep can observe a 0-byte file mid-write. waitForEntries() polls for * the expected entry COUNT — deterministic under lock retries. */ const os = require('os'); const path = require('path'); const fs = require('fs'); const TMP_DIR = fs.mkdtempSync(path.join(os.tmpdir(), 'dc110-audit-')); process.env.AUDIT_LOG_FILE = path.join(TMP_DIR, 'audit-log.json'); process.env.SECURITY_EVENT_LOG_FILE = path.join(TMP_DIR, 'security-events.jsonl'); const AuditLogger = require('../src/security/audit-logger'); async function waitForEntries(count, timeoutMs = 5000) { const deadline = Date.now() + timeoutMs; for (;;) { try { const entries = JSON.parse(fs.readFileSync(process.env.AUDIT_LOG_FILE, 'utf8')); if (Array.isArray(entries) && entries.length >= count) return entries; } catch (_) { /* not yet: 0-byte mid-write or unparsed */ } if (Date.now() > deadline) throw new Error(`timed out waiting for ${count} audit entries`); await new Promise(r => setTimeout(r, 15)); } } describe('AuditLogger [DC-110] PII masking parity', () => { test('log() masks emails in resource path and deep details', async () => { await AuditLogger.log({ action: 'invite.create', resource: 'invites/john.doe@example.com/accept', details: { body: { email: 'jane.doe@example.com', role: 'admin' }, userEmail: 'sami@example.org', }, outcome: 'success', ip: '10.1.2.3', }); const entries = await waitForEntries(1); expect(entries).toHaveLength(1); const e = entries[0]; // resource: local part truncated to 2 chars + **** + domain, path suffix kept expect(e.resource).toBe('invites/jo****@example.com/accept'); // deep details masked with the canonical shape expect(e.details.body.email).toBe('ja****@example.com'); expect(e.details.userEmail).toBe('sa****@example.org'); expect(e.details.body.role).toBe('admin'); // non-PII untouched // structural fields untouched expect(e.action).toBe('invite.create'); expect(e.outcome).toBe('success'); expect(e.ip).toBe('10.1.2.3'); expect(e.id).toMatch(/^[0-9a-f-]{36}$/); // no raw email anywhere in the serialized file const raw = fs.readFileSync(process.env.AUDIT_LOG_FILE, 'utf8'); expect(raw).not.toContain('john.doe@example.com'); expect(raw).not.toContain('jane.doe@example.com'); expect(raw).not.toContain('sami@example.org'); expect(raw).not.toContain('.doe@'); // no partial-local leaks either }); test("caller's details object is never mutated", async () => { const details = { body: { email: 'orig@example.com' }, userEmail: 'orig2@example.net' }; const before = JSON.stringify(details); await AuditLogger.log({ action: 'x.y', resource: 'r', details, outcome: 'success', ip: '' }); const entries = await waitForEntries(2); expect(JSON.stringify(details)).toBe(before); // untouched at the call site expect(entries[0].details.body.email).toBe('or****@example.com'); // masked only in the entry }); test('middleware end-to-end: body, note, userEmail land masked; *** redaction survives', async () => { const mw = AuditLogger.middleware(); const req = { method: 'POST', path: '/api/v1/invites', ip: '192.168.1.50', body: { email: 'invitee@example.com', note: 'for jane.doe@corp.example.com', password: 'hunter2', token: 'abc123', }, params: {}, user: { id: 'u1', role: 'admin', email: 'admin@example.io' }, }; const res = { json: jest.fn() }; mw(req, res, () => {}); res.json({ success: true }); const entries = await waitForEntries(3); const e = entries[0]; expect(e.details.body.email).toBe('in****@example.com'); expect(e.details.body.note).toBe('for ja****@corp.example.com'); // sensitive-key redaction (middleware sanitize) intact alongside masking expect(e.details.body.password).toBe('***'); expect(e.details.body.token).toBe('***'); // DC-048 attribution intact + masked expect(e.details.userId).toBe('u1'); expect(e.details.userEmail).toBe('ad****@example.io'); expect(e.outcome).toBe('success'); }); test('already-masked entries stay stable (idempotent shape)', async () => { await AuditLogger.log({ action: 'x.masked', resource: 'users/jo****@example.com/reset', details: { body: { email: 'jo****@example.com' } }, outcome: 'success', ip: '', }); const entries = await waitForEntries(4); const e = entries[0]; // '*' is not in the local-part class, so the masked form does not re-match expect(e.resource).toBe('users/jo****@example.com/reset'); expect(e.details.body.email).toBe('jo****@example.com'); }); test('entries without emails are structurally unchanged', async () => { await AuditLogger.log({ action: 'service.create', resource: 'services/nginx', details: { body: { name: 'nginx', port: 8080 } }, outcome: 'success', ip: '172.16.0.4', }); const entries = await waitForEntries(5); const e = entries[0]; expect(e.resource).toBe('services/nginx'); expect(e.details.body.name).toBe('nginx'); expect(e.details.body.port).toBe(8080); }); test('security-event mirror carries MASKED target/message (judge round-2 fix)', async () => { await AuditLogger.log({ action: 'invite.create', resource: 'invites/john.doe@example.com/accept', details: { body: { email: 'jane.doe@example.com' } }, outcome: 'success', ip: '10.5.5.5', }); // The mirror write is queued by event-store — poll for our line to land. const deadline = Date.now() + 5000; let mirrorRaw = ''; for (;;) { try { mirrorRaw = fs.readFileSync(process.env.SECURITY_EVENT_LOG_FILE, 'utf8'); } catch (_) {} if (mirrorRaw.includes('invite.create')) break; if (Date.now() > deadline) throw new Error('mirror line never landed in security-events.jsonl'); await new Promise(r => setTimeout(r, 15)); } const line = mirrorRaw.split('\n').find(l => l.includes('invite.create')); const ev = JSON.parse(line); expect(ev.target).toBe('invites/jo****@example.com/accept'); expect(ev.message).toBe('invite.create success on invites/jo****@example.com/accept'); // no raw email anywhere in the mirror file expect(mirrorRaw).not.toContain('john.doe@example.com'); expect(mirrorRaw).not.toContain('jane.doe@example.com'); }); });
